Chinese Food - The Best Option For Good Health

The Chinese food is very good for health as it is cooked with the purpose of enhancing the health benefits, such as long life, healing powers and medicinal value. It requires a good knowledge and experience to prepare the Oriental cuisine. It is cooked with poly unsaturated oils and no milk based ingredients like cream, butter or cheese are used. Though meat is also used, it is not used in excess to avoid high amounts of animal fat and cholesterol. Such type of food is called genuine Chinese food, which is actually a perfect diet for good health. The traditional food must include rice, noodles and vegetables.

The way of serving the food is also very special. It is almost obligatory to cut the food into small pieces before serving, and there will be no knives at the dining table. The right combination of things like herbs and condiments is very important. The food should be tempting in color and texture and must be enjoyed in peace. You can choose from a wide variety of dishes having different nutritional value. Chicken or beef and vegetables are a good combination. One can have cashew chicken or beef and broccoli in place of fried dishes like sesame chicken. Such dishes are very nutritious while the traditional foods like lo mien having noodles soaked in oil, fats and carbohydrates are not good for health.

Take brown rice instead of fried rice to avoid high levels of cholesterol and carbohydrates. Soy sauce and other additives rich in sodium content are basically used in Chinese food. But as you know, a lot of sodium is harmful, avoid too much sauce and go for vegetables and steamed dishes or stir fried using little or no oil. To reduce fat calories, take a healthy diet containing vegetable based dishes having some sauces and steamed rice. Taking fortune cookies at the end of the meal would be great.

To conclude, a Chinese food with a lot of vegetables, snow peas, and low in salt is considered a healthy food. The quality of the food also depends on your choice of the restaurant, whether it is a low-priced one or a high end restaurant. The waiter or the manager would also be keen to guide you about the kind of dishes and their nutritional value. So, it is very important for your health to select the right place and the right things to eat.

How Does the American Chinese Food Differ From the Native Oriental Cuisine?

American Chinese food is different from the native Oriental cuisine in many ways. In the former, vegetables are used to decorate the food, whereas in the Chinese cuisines, vegetables are the main ingredients. This is very obvious in the use of carrots and tomatoes. The use of Asian leafy vegetables and a lot of fresh meat and seafood is very common in the native Chinese cuisine on the other hand. Besides, American Chinese food is generally less spicy than the native Chinese food. Usually, local ingredients common in America but no often used in China, are used to prepare the dishes. For example, the use of broccoli is very common in the Americanized version, while it is rarely used in the authentic cuisine.

American Chinese dishes are very easy to prepare and take less time in cooking. Many dishes are cooked very quickly with a lot of oil and salt. Generally, low-priced ingredients and the most common methods of cooking, such as stir-frying, pan-frying, and deep-frying are used. All the cooking can be easily done with the help of a wok. American Chinese food contains high amount of MSG which is used to add flavor to the food. But many restaurants serve 'MSG Free' or 'NO MSG' options, because some customers may be glutamate sensitive. However, cautiously done scientific research has shown no such negative effects of glutamate.

Mostly, American Chinese restaurants have menus written in English or having pictures, as they cater to non-Chinese consumers. Some restaurants have separate Chinese-language menus also featuring treats like liver, chicken feet or some other striking meat dishes that might dissuade Western clients. In New York's Chinatown, the restaurants are infamous for saying no to provide non-Chinese Americans the "secret" menu that features the genuine Chinese dishes. Thus, American Chinese cuisine differs a lot from the native oriental food in terms of taste, ingredients and the way of cooking.
